Understanding Begonia Rex Light Requirements
Begonia Rex prefers bright, indirect light. Direct sunlight can scorch its delicate leaves, while too little light can cause the colors to fade. Finding the right balance is key to maintaining its vibrant appearance.
Ideal Locations for Your Begonia Rex
- Near an east-facing window with gentle morning sun
- Near a north-facing window with filtered light
- In a well-lit room away from direct sunlight
- On a bright, but shaded, shelf or table
Locations to Avoid
- Direct sunlight from a south or west-facing window
- Dark corners or poorly lit areas
- Near heating vents or air conditioners
- Places with sudden drafts or temperature fluctuations
Additional Tips for Placement
Rotate your Begonia Rex periodically to ensure even light exposure. Keep the plant away from cold windows during winter nights. Using sheer curtains can help diffuse harsh sunlight, protecting the leaves from damage.
Monitoring Your Plant’s Light Conditions
Observe your Begonia Rex regularly. If the leaves start to fade or lose their vibrant colors, it may need more light. Conversely, if the leaves appear scorched or develop brown edges, it is receiving too much direct sunlight.
